Our Story

About Samarpan Music

Music is a lifelong journey. It is not a destination you arrive at, but a companion that grows with you — through your first hesitant swara, through years of patient riyaz, and through every performance that follows. At Samarpan Music, we honour that journey rather than rushing it.

Hindustani Classical Music develops discipline, creativity, and self-expression. The daily practice sharpens focus and listening; the ragas open up an emotional vocabulary that words rarely reach; and improvisation teaches you to trust your own voice while staying faithful to a tradition centuries old.

Every student receives personalised guidance in a warm and encouraging learning environment. Lessons are shaped around your voice, your pace and your goals — whether you sing for the pure love of it, for the stage, or simply to bring a little more stillness into your week.

Workshops & Courses

Structured programmes for every stage

Short, focused workshops that fit around real life — taught live, recorded for your practice, and open to learners anywhere in the world.

Build a reliable ear and a steady voice. We work on shruti, breath support, alankaras and the discipline of daily riyaz, so that every note you sing sits exactly where it should.
